Rockstar Lincoln is on the lookout for talented Associate QA Testers of Online Services, Website/Commerce, and Digital Distribution Platforms at any level of experience who possess a passion for quality.

This is a full-time, permanent and in-office position based in Rockstar’s unique game development studio in Lincoln, England. 

WHAT WE DO

  • Ensure the quality and reliability of Rockstar’s online services, websites and platforms in support of multiple Industry leading titles.
  • Create and work through comprehensive test plans to ensure everything is functioning correctly.
  • Write up bug reports concisely explaining issues and providing required information and attachments.
  • Work cohesively with other departments to gain a full understanding of all systems in test.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Identifying, investigating, clarifying and documenting defects encountered during testing.
  • Test of all associated Rockstar online services, updates, live events, sweepstakes and maintenance for all supported titles.
  • Test of all Rockstar online services related features for all upcoming titles and title updates.
  • Test of all Rockstar online services admin and customer support tools for all supported and upcoming titles.
  • Test of all Rockstar Games websites updates, including the Rockstar Store.
  • Test of Rockstar Games Launcher and associated tools.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• The ability to communicate effectively with people at all levels.
  • Knowledge and experience of current and previous gen (Xbox One & PS4) consoles.
  • Knowledge and Experience of PC Gaming and associated digital platforms e.g. Steam, Epic, etc.
  • Knowledge of and experience with Microsoft Office suite.

SKILLS

  • The ability to multitask and work to deadlines.
  • Excellent attention to detail.
  • The ability to quickly learn and adapt to highly technical tasks.
  • The ability to work productively and collaboratively, respecting others' opinions.
  • The ability to remain focused when approaching repetitive tasks.
  • Ability to become accustomed to various in-house software systems.
  • Ability to multitask and handle rapidly changing situations.

PLUSES

Please note that these are desirable skills and are not required to apply for the position.

  • Experience with a variety of database software.
  • Experience of testing web based applications and web sites.
  • Experience of using online service tools such as Fiddler and Wireshark.
  • Experience of working with ecommerce platforms and processes.
  • Experience within QA at any level.
  • Basic understanding of any of the following: HTML, JavaScript, CSS, C# or C++.
  • Experience automating tests.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ION

  • Candidates must be 18 years of age and above.
  • This is a two-stage application process. You will first be asked to complete a video interview; from which you may be asked to attend an onsite interview with the team.
  • We are currently looking to hire for our Night Shift only (6:30pm – 3:00am).
